Hello everyone,
I am currently testing myself in Copilot Studio with my first own Copilot.
I have connected a graph connector as a knowledge source, which runs against an on-premise SQL database.
The connector indexes my data correctly.
However, I only get “Unknown” as the status in Copilot Studio.

When I try to create a generative answer with this data source, I get the following error message: Authentication errors are present in at least one of these sources.
What can I do here to fix the error?

    Now I've come a few steps further.
    The status in the knowledge base remains unknown. Maybe I'm missing rights here or it's because of the display language German.
    For anyone who is interested in how to fix the authentication error with a generative answer in connection with a graph connector (for example SQL Server), please follow the instructions below:
     
    It appears that manual authentication of the user is mandatory in order to use data from an external graph data source.
     
    Unfortunately, no results are returned from the source.
    Maybe someone here has an idea what else I should change.
     
    I have made the following API authorizations:
    - ExternalItem.Read.All
    - Files.Read.All
    - openid
    - profile
    - Sites.Read.All
    - User.Read
